50609426 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 91325760. Its totient is φ = 20548080.
The previous prime is 50609417. The next prime is 50609431. The reversal of 50609426 is 62490605.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×506094262 = 5122628000098952, which contains 22 as substring.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 50609392 and 50609401.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 94865 + ... + 95396.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(5707860).
Almost surely, 250609426 is an apocalyptic number.
50609426 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(40716334).
50609426 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
50609426 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 190289.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 12960, while the sum is 32.
The square root of 50609426 is about 7114.0302220331. The cubic root of 50609426 is about 369.8938726546.
